Important:
Fusion Connector users (versions 15.x or 16.x): You must uninstall your current version of Desktop Connector before installing v17.x. Docs connector users can upgrade directly and should not uninstall first. For complete instructions, see Update Desktop Connector.
What's New
Reset Utility improvements
- Reset Utility now performs preflight checks: The Reset Utility now verifies it can complete the reset operation before making any changes, ensuring the reset will complete correctly and preventing partial cleanup operations.
- Reset Utility now removes shell extensions: The Reset Utility now properly removes shell extensions such as drag and drop handlers during the reset process, ensuring a more complete cleanup.
Stability & reliability enhancements
- Fixed false delete notifications after reinstalling: Resolved an issue where Desktop Connector would show delete notifications for all files after uninstalling and reinstalling the application. The uninstaller now properly cleans up databases and detects invalid workspace states to prevent this issue.
- Fixed workspace rename functionality: Resolved an issue where Desktop Connector could not properly rename corrupted workspaces. The application now correctly checks if databases are empty rather than just checking if they exist.
- Fixed rare crash during workspace scanning: Resolved an edge case crash that could occur when the application was unable to process certain detected changes during a workspace scan.
